Bobby was employed at the Garland County Road Department for 32 years, working his way up from a grader operator to the Garland County Road Commissioner. Prior to that he worked at McClards BBQ.
He was a devoted and loving son, husband, father, grandfather and friend. He had many hobbies and talents, including photography, artwork, fishing, golfing, playing his guitar and handicapping the horses at Oaklawn. His most cherished moments were the times spent with his grandchildren they were the light of his life.
Services were at 10 am, Monday, February 2 in the Davis-Smith Funeral Home Chapel, Brother Nathan Morse officiated, interment followed in Memorial Gardens Cemetery, Hot Springs, Arkansas.
Honorary pallbearers are the Garland County Judge Larry Williams, employees of the Garland County Road Department, Dr. Robert Muldoon and the staff of The Genesis Center and Spa Construction Company.
In lieu of flowers the family requests memorials be made to the American Cancer Society, P.O. Box 22718, Oklahoma City, OK 73123-1718
Bobby will be greatly missed by his family and many friends. Gone from our presence forever in our hearts.
